The Company – Trainee Recruitment Consultant

Founded in 2016, weve steadily grown to become a prominent player in the tech recruitment sector, particularly focused on the UK market. With our expertise, we help connect top talent with some of the most innovative tech firms globally, offering high-value roles with substantial earning potential.

In the next phase of our growth, were excited to announce plans to expand into the US, with a new office opening in Miami in summer 2025. This follows the successful launches of our offices in London and Dubai. Were on the lookout for driven individuals who recognise the unique opportunity this expansion offers.

As part of our team, you\’ll work with leading tech companies such as Google, Amazon, and Microsoft, gaining direct exposure to clients from the outset and even having the chance to meet them in person. And yes, this includes an all-expenses-paid trip to the US

The Role – Trainee Recruitment Consultant

  • Cold Calling potential clients and candidates, pitching the services/ role you can offer them, whilst also dealing with the rejection that can take place as a result of this.
  • Guiding candidates through the process offing advice and support on different stages of the process whilst also being responsible for any negotiations that may subsequently take place.
  • Negotiating deals.
  • Attending client meetings to gain a greater insight/ understanding of what exactly they are looking for in their new hires.
  • Market research in order to stay up to date with new developments within your sector.

How to prepare for a job interview at Rule Recruitment

✨Research the Company

Before your interview, take some time to learn about the recruitment firm and its specialisation in technology and digital transformation. Understanding their values, mission, and the types of roles they fill will help you tailor your answers and show genuine interest.

✨Prepare for Common Questions

Anticipate questions that may be asked during the interview, such as your motivation for pursuing a career in recruitment or how you handle challenges. Practising your responses can help you feel more confident and articulate during the actual interview.

✨Showcase Your Communication Skills

As a Trainee Recruitment Consultant, strong communication skills are essential. During the interview, make sure to express your thoughts clearly and concisely. Use examples from your past experiences to demonstrate your ability to communicate effectively.

✨Highlight Your Adaptability

The technology and digital transformation sectors are fast-paced and ever-changing. Be prepared to discuss how you adapt to new situations and learn quickly. Sharing specific examples of when you've successfully navigated change can set you apart from other candidates.
